Why Carpenter Bees Are a Serious Problem for Surf City Homes
Carpenter bees are often underestimated because they do not behave like large hive-forming pests such as honey bees or yellow jackets. However, that does not make them harmless to your property. In Surf City, where outdoor wood features are common on porches, railings, soffits, fascia boards, sheds, fences, pergolas, and decks, carpenter bees can become a recurring structural nuisance. Instead of building visible nests, they bore directly into unfinished or weathered wood, creating smooth, round entry holes and internal tunnels where they lay eggs. Over time, those tunnels can expand, and when the same wood is targeted year after year, the damage can become more extensive and costly to repair.
One of the biggest issues with carpenter bees is repetition. A single season of activity may seem minor, but the real concern develops when multiple generations return to the same nesting sites. Old galleries can be reused and expanded, which weakens wooden materials and creates more visible damage. In many cases, homeowners first notice the buzzing activity but overlook the actual entry points until the infestation grows. Others may see staining beneath the holes, wood shavings, or signs that woodpeckers have begun pecking at the boards in search of larvae. That secondary damage can make the problem even worse.
Another challenge is that carpenter bee infestations are not always isolated to one spot. If your property has several appealing wood surfaces, activity can appear in multiple areas at once. Signs You Need a Carpenter Bee Exterminator in Surf City
Many homeowners do not realize they have a carpenter bee issue until the infestation becomes more noticeable. The earliest signs are often subtle, especially if the bees are nesting in upper trim, behind railings, under eaves, or along the back side of wooden structures that are not checked often. One of the most recognizable warning signs is the presence of perfectly round holes in wood surfaces. Unlike rough damage caused by decay or splintering, carpenter bee entry holes usually look smooth and deliberate. You may also find coarse sawdust or drilling residue beneath the hole, which is a strong clue that fresh boring activity has occurred.
Another common sign is repeated bee hovering around the same area. Carpenter bees are often seen flying close to decks, porch ceilings, fascia boards, shutters, and wooden playsets. Males may appear aggressive when guarding nesting areas, even though they do not sting, while females are responsible for tunneling and nesting. If you notice bees consistently returning to one section of your home, especially sunny, exposed wood, there is a good chance there is an active nesting site nearby. This repeated behavior is often a signal that the infestation is established rather than accidental.
Homeowners may also notice cosmetic and secondary damage. Yellowish staining below holes can result from bee waste, while woodpecker damage may appear when birds target infested wood to feed on developing larvae. What starts as a few holes can quickly turn into multiple weakened areas across visible wood surfaces. If these sections are left untreated, the next season often brings renewed activity in the same places.
